I'm Faith. I work with what the body holds.
I'm a somatic wellness practitioner based in Central, Hong Kong. I'm a certified Biodynamic and Upledger Craniosacral Therapist, a certified Rebirthing Breathwork practitioner, and I'm completing a 3-year professional training in Somatic Experiencing, the body-based trauma approach developed by Dr. Peter Levine.
I run a private practice in Central, Hong Kong. The people who find their way to me are ready to work at the level of the body. They bring curiosity, a willingness to slow down, and a sense that there is more to reach.
The work is somatic at the heart, polyvagal-informed at the frame. The room is held quietly and directly, with the science to back it up. Whatever surfaces is met as information, not as a problem to fix.
